Prior to becoming Pope, Jorge Mario Bergoglio was able to cook simple and healthy meals.

Pope Francis, prior to his ascension to the papacy, had a background as a chemical technician, having studied for this profession and worked briefly in the food processing industry.

Although there are no reports that he specifically graduated in “Food Chemistry,” his background in chemistry and experience in the food industry suggest a practical understanding of principles related to food.

There are reports that, before becoming Pope, the then Archbishop Jorge Mario Bergoglio enjoyed cooking his own simple meals in his quarters in Buenos Aires. He prepared healthy dishes such as skinless roasted chicken, vegetables, salads, and fruits.

After his election as Pope in 2013, he chose not to reside in the papal apartments but instead in the Casa Santa Marta in the Vatican. There, he used to have his meals in the common dining hall alongside other residents and staff. This decision reflects his well-known humble lifestyle and his preference for simplicity and closeness to people.
